package com.speedment.core.runtime;
import com.speedment.core.config.model.External;
import com.speedment.core.config.model.Project;
import com.speedment.core.config.model.aspects.Node;
import com.speedment.core.config.model.impl.utils.GroovyParser;
import com.speedment.core.config.model.impl.utils.MethodsParser;
import com.speedment.core.core.Buildable;
import com.speedment.core.lifecycle.AbstractLifecycle;
import com.speedment.core.manager.Manager;
import com.speedment.core.exception.SpeedmentException;
import com.speedment.core.platform.Platform;
import com.speedment.core.platform.component.ManagerComponent;
import com.speedment.core.platform.component.ProjectComponent;
import com.speedment.core.runtime.typemapping.StandardJavaTypeMapping;
import static com.speedment.util.Beans.beanPropertyName;
import com.speedment.util.Trees;
import java.io.IOException;
import java.lang.reflect.InvocationTargetException;
import java.nio.file.Path;
import java.util.List;
import java.util.Map;
import java.util.Optional;
import java.util.concurrent.ConcurrentHashMap;
import java.util.function.Consumer;
import java.util.function.Function;
import static java.util.stream.Collectors.toList;
import java.util.stream.Stream;
/**
*
* @author pemi
* @param <T> The type of the Lifecycle
*/
public abstract class SpeedmentApplicationLifecycle<T extends SpeedmentApplicationLifecycle<T>> extends AbstractLifecycle<T> {
private String dbmsPassword;
private final Map<String, String> dbmsPasswords;
private ApplicationMetadata speedmentApplicationMetadata;
private Path configPath;
public SpeedmentApplicationLifecycle() {
super();
configPath = null;
dbmsPasswords = new ConcurrentHashMap<>();
}
/**
* Configures a password for all dbmses in this project. The password will
* then be applied after the configuration has been read and after the
* System properties has been applied but before
* configureDbmsPassword(dbmsName, password) is called.
*
* @param password the password to use for all dbms:es in this project.
* @return this instance
*/
public T configureDbmsPassword(final String password) {
dbmsPassword = password;
return self();
}
/**
* Configures a password for the named dbms. The password will then be
* applied after the configuration has been read and after the System
* properties has been applied.
*
* @param dbmsName the name of the dbms
* @param password the password to use for the named dbms.
* @return this instance
*/
public T configureDbmsPassword(final String dbmsName, final String password) {
dbmsPasswords.put(dbmsName, password);
return self();
}
@Override
protected void onInit() {
forEachManagerInSeparateThread(mgr -> mgr.initialize());
}
@Override
protected void onResolve() {
forEachManagerInSeparateThread(mgr -> mgr.resolve());
}
@Override
protected void onStart() {
forEachManagerInSeparateThread(mgr -> mgr.start());
}
@Override
protected void onStop() {
forEachManagerInSeparateThread(mgr -> mgr.stop());
}
protected void loadAndSetProject() {
try {
final Optional<Path> oPath = getConfigPath();
final Project project;
if (oPath.isPresent()) {
project = GroovyParser.projectFromGroovy(oPath.get());
} else {
project = GroovyParser.projectFromGroovy(getSpeedmentApplicationMetadata().getMetadata());
}
// Apply overridden values from the system properties (if any)
final Function<Node, Stream<Node>> traverser = n -> n.asParent().map(p -> p.stream()).orElse(Stream.empty()).map(c -> (Node) c);
Trees.traverse(project, traverser, Trees.TraversalOrder.DEPTH_FIRST_PRE)
.forEach((Node node) -> {
final Class<?> clazz = node.getClass();
MethodsParser.streamOfExternalSetters(clazz).forEach(
method -> {
final String path = "speedment.project." + node.getRelativeName(Project.class) + "." + beanPropertyName(method);
Optional.ofNullable(System.getProperty(path)).ifPresent(propString -> {
final External external = MethodsParser.getExternalFor(method, clazz);
final Class<?> targetJavaType = external.type();
final Object val = StandardJavaTypeMapping.parse(targetJavaType, propString);
try {
method.invoke(node, val);
} catch (IllegalAccessException | IllegalArgumentException | InvocationTargetException e) {
throw new SpeedmentException("Unable to invoke " + method + " for " + node + " with argument " + val + " (" + propString + ")");
}
});
}
);
});
// Apply overidden passwords (if any) for all dbms:es
Optional.ofNullable(dbmsPassword).ifPresent(pwd -> {
project.stream().forEach(dbms -> dbms.setPassword(pwd));
});
// Apply overidden passwords (if any) for any named dbms
project.stream().forEach(dbms -> {
Optional.ofNullable(dbmsPasswords.get(dbms.getName())).ifPresent(pwd -> dbms.setPassword(pwd));
});
Platform.get().get(ProjectComponent.class).setProject(project);
} catch (IOException ioe) {
throw new SpeedmentException("Failed to read config file", ioe);
}
}
protected <PK, E, B extends Buildable<E>> void put(Manager<PK, E, B> manager) {
Platform.get().get(ManagerComponent.class).put(manager);
}
public T setSpeedmentApplicationMetadata(ApplicationMetadata speedmentApplicationMetadata) {
this.speedmentApplicationMetadata = speedmentApplicationMetadata;
return self();
}
protected ApplicationMetadata getSpeedmentApplicationMetadata() {
return speedmentApplicationMetadata;
}
public T setConfigPath(Path configPath) {
this.configPath = configPath;
return self();
}
protected Optional<Path> getConfigPath() {
return Optional.ofNullable(configPath);
}
@Override
public String toString() {
return super.toString() + ", path=" + getConfigPath().toString();
}

// Utilities
protected void forEachManagerInSeparateThread(Consumer<Manager<?, ?, ?>> managerConsumer) {
final ManagerComponent mc = Platform.get().get(ManagerComponent.class);
final List<Thread> threads = mc.stream().map(mgr -> new Thread(() -> managerConsumer.accept(mgr))).collect(toList());
threads.forEach(t -> t.start());
threads.forEach(t -> {
try {
t.join();
} catch (InterruptedException ex) {
// ignore
}
});
}
}
